Sewa - Samudrapur, Wardha

Sewa is a village situated in the Samudrapur tehsil of Wardha district, Maharashtra. It is located approximately 20 km from the tehsil headquarters in Samudrapur and around 50 km from the district headquarters in Wardha. Sewa village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Sewa is 534650. The village covers a total geographical area of 358.15 hectares and falls under the 442301 pincode. Hinganghat is the nearest town, located about 14 km away.

Sewa village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Sewa

According to the 2011 Census, Sewa village had a total population of 367 people, including 201 males and 166 females, living in 101 households. The sex ratio was 826 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 78.21%, with male literacy at 85.79% and female literacy at 69.08%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 36, while the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 19.

Transport and Connectivity of Sewa

Public transport in the Sewa is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is Tuljapur, while the nearest airport is Dr. Babasaheb Ambedkar International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 37.4 km.

In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Hinganghat to Sewa is about 14 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Wardha to Sewa is about 50 km, with the usual travel time around ~1.4 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
